Yes there is a demand for sure, but it is NOT a removable part and is molded into the back in such a way as to be very difficult to repair. I thought of making very thin metal tabs that would epoxy over the broke off tab, but then you would probably chew up the mating plastic catch on the body.
It's not a simple fix, or a fix would already be flooding he market IMHO...
